Ralph Horowitz’ Flemington Best Bets Posted on June 21, 2019June 21, 2019 | Posted by Ralph Horowitz Ralph Horowitz’ Best Bets Race 4 LAST WEEK with the place on side Very keen here with the “double golden switch” LAST WEEK going from apprentice to in form Jye McNeil and inside barrier to 7 of 10 here after being “stuck” on the fence last start behind the tiring BOOM TIME and losing all momentum as CHOUXTING THE MOB had full throttle. Note the market was $2:50 v $13 for a reason, and LAST WEEK was having his first distance run this prep while the winner was rock hard fit. Confident he’ll turn the tables, but a bit wary of PACODALI. As such keeping the place on side. Race 7 HALVORSEN win save BAM’S ON FIRE Pretty keen on HALVORSEN but BAM’S ON FIRE is going too well to lose on if she wins. HALVORSEN has clearly the best 1200 form in the race with an excellent Moonee Valley win in January over Hawkshot, and then went even better when 2nd to TIN HAT at Caulfield. Last start showed the straight is no concern beaten a nose by rock hard fit GYTRASH over 1000 which is a bit short for him. If he brings his A-game he should win. BAM’S ON FIRE is on fire winning all three starts this prep. Yet to produce a big overall time, but she should still have a big peak here. Race 8 SURE KNEE win Filly having her 3rd consecutive run at Flemington, but the 18/05 head 2nd to the flying FIDELIA in a high pressure mile, was in total contrast to her last start when also getting back, but in a significantly slower tempo. She was $2:10 for a reason in that race, but given no chance from where she settled in the run after an early check. Monster jockey change of Newitt off for Williams riding for the title, and from barrier 5 doubt he’ll be worse than mid-field. If she brings what she did two starts back only bad luck can beat here.
